摘要
Polycarbosilane was synthesized from polydimethylsilane in the presence of ZSM-5 (Si/Al=30) as a catalyst at 350 degrees C-400 degrees C. Characterization of synthesized polycarbosilane was performed with Si-29 Solid NMR, FT-IR, and GPC analysis. Number average of molecular weight (M-n) of the polycarbosilane was ranged from 350 to 2340.
